Building a subscription channel using instant TV channel
I am building a private subscription channel using instant TV channel. How do you build one that provides the viewer with a preview version of the channel that allows them to upgrade to the full channel using their Roku remote?

Re: Building a subscription channel using instant TV channel
Actually some of the devs here do use Instant TV Channel.
And devs using Instant TV Channel still use the Roku Developer Site to upload their Pkg file, set up the channel, and monitor performance. They still use the blackbox RAF code.
BlueBoy, Roku's In-Channel Purchasing is supported in Instant TV Channel. Individual content items in a channel can be configured with or without In-Channel Purchasing, so some items can be free and some can be paid. Or you can put a "Preview" or "Trailer" button into the Springboard screens to allow a preview of the video.
But Squirreltown is right, this type of question should be asked using the contact email address on the Instant TV Channel website, you'll usually get a quicker response.
